King Solomon
King Solomon, also known as Solomon ben David, was traditionally attributed as the author of several biblical books, including the Song of Songs. Solomon was the son of King David and Bathsheba and is most famous for his wisdom, wealth, and building projects, notably the First Temple in Jerusalem. His reign is often considered the peak of the Israelite monarchy in terms of prosperity and stability. The historical accuracy of his authorship has been debated among scholars, with many suggesting that the Song of Songs was written by multiple authors or during a later period.
